The Assembly is an independent neighbourhood bar and bottle shop in East Leeds, offering a great selection of drinks, bar snacks, and a friendly, cosy atmosphere.
Regulars and our editors tag it for craft beer, wine bar, bar snacks, cosy atmosphere, bottle shop, outside seating and independent bar.

The Assembly is open Tue–Thu 15:00–23:00; Friday 15:00–23:30; Saturday 13:00–23:30; Sunday 13:00–22:30. It is closed Monday. Hours can change over bank holidays and big fixtures, so check before a late start.
